VDC secys still working from district HQ, tweaking records, gobbling up elderly allowances

Kathmandu, February 9

Most of the secretaries of village development committees have still been discharging their duties from district headquarters instead of returning to their duty stations in villages, despite improvements in law and order situation. The Ministry of Local Development found this in course of monitoring that covered 27 district development committee offices. 27 municipalities and 32 VDC offices. Ministry joint-secretaries have prepred a report pointing that VDC secretaries have not been serving members of the public from their respective duty stations.

The monitoring team found VDC secretaries to be indulging in irregularities while registering individual life events. It found that these government staff do not bother to note down the date of death while registering deaths nor do they ask people to sign on the records while registering such events. A monitoring team member said: This way, VDC secretaries even gobble up allowances meant for senior citizens.

Some VDC secretaries and DDC offices do not even implement the directives coming from the Commission for the Investigation of Abuse of Authority, National Vigilence Centre and the ministry, the team found in course of monitoring.

The team also found an increase in arrears in VDC offices. These offices make advance payment, but do not bother to clear the arrears, the report states.
